Ingleford Scaffolding Ltd has an exciting opportunity to join our growing business as a Wagon Driver. Based in Washington, Tyne and Wear supplying scaffold across the North East for over 10 years.

**About the Role**
- Relevant experience in a similar role (required)
- Digital Tachograph Card (in-date)
- Valid HGV License
- Valid CPC (preferred)
- Knowledge of load security using rachet straps and other methods
- Good knowledge of the area (preferred)

**Key Responsibilities**

The key responsibilities of the role will include all aspects of contract management, including:

- Deliver materials to site using Hiab vehicle
- Loading / unloading equipment and materials
- Refuel on-site
- Completion of daily vehicle inspections and reporting defects to transport department
- Completion and submission of all company paperwork as per procedure.
- Safeguard all Company assets; nothing leaves the depot without correct paperwork.
- Ensure company vehicle or occasional loan vehicle supplied, is kept clean and tidy at all times, serviced within manufacturer’s guideline, and ensure any defects are notified to correct parties and rectified in a timely manner.
